More about the book

The book features a collection of fourteen essays that blend political, philosophical, historical, and personal insights, reflecting the author's journey from childhood in Massachusetts to teaching in Tennessee and coping with loss. It examines the legacy of slavery and offers sociological analyses, all articulated in Du Bois's impactful prose. Through various narratives, it highlights the complexities of the Black experience and addresses the enduring issue of racial division, urging readers to confront and resolve these challenges in contemporary society.
